About Our SchoolLocated in Wigan, our new school provides a safe and supportive environment for pupils aged 5 to 16. As part of the Polaris Community, we have been dedicated to improving the lives of young people for over 30 years. With twelve SEN Schools across the UK, we work collaboratively to offer each pupil a tailored, engaging, and appropriate education that inspires learning and encourages achievement. We are proud to have 100% of our Education services rated as Good or Outstanding by Ofsted.
Your Role and Responsibilities- Plan and deliver high-quality lessons within the national curriculum, addressing the complex ASC & SEMH needs of all pupils.
- Support the class team in facilitating learning opportunities and promoting positive behaviors.
- Report on pupils' progress and concerns, collaborating with other school staff to meet pupils' needs.
- Supervise pupils during non-classroom time, including extracurricular activities and school trips.
- Build positive relationships with pupils to drive interaction and achieve positive learning outcomes.
